The Mechanics of Preservation
Understanding how a saved page functions requires looking at the technology behind the snapshot. Unlike a bookmark which only stores the URL, a saved page often creates a local copy of the HTML, images, and sometimes the associated CSS and JavaScript. This allows the content to be viewed offline and in its original formatting. The integrity of this archive depends on the tool used, with some methods capturing the live DOM while others generate a static HTML file that represents the state at the exact moment of capture.
Combating Digital Ephemerality
Websites are not permanent; layouts change, articles are de-indexed, and products are delisted. Relying solely on a standard hyperlink is risky because the destination can vanish or become irrelevant. By saving page now, you mitigate the risk of link rot. This is particularly crucial for research, legal documentation, or evidence collection, where the exact wording and context of a source must be provably identical to the version that existed at a specific point in time.

Legal and Compliance Considerations
In legal, financial, and regulatory environments, the act of saving page now takes on a more significant weight. Compliance teams often require immutable records of web content for audits or legal proceedings. A standard screenshot or HTML save provides a timestamped exhibit that demonstrates what information was publicly available at a specific date. This practice supports due diligence and helps organizations meet archival requirements for digital communications.
Technical Execution and Tools
There are multiple pathways to achieve a preserved copy, ranging from native browser functions to specialized software. The most common method involves the "Save Page As" feature found in most modern browsers, which generates a MHTML or single-file HTML package. Alternatively, command-line tools like `wget` or `curl` offer precision for developers, while dedicated archival services leverage web crawlers to create robust, long-term snapshots resistant to even domain expiration.
Ensuring Authenticity and Trust
Beyond simple access, the saved page must maintain its credibility. When reviewing historical evidence or verifying a source, the viewer needs to trust that the content has not been tampered with since capture. Modern archival solutions provide cryptographic hashes or blockchain-based timestamps to prove authenticity. This transforms a simple copy into a trusted artifact, providing confidence in the validity of the preserved information for professional and academic use.
